A common diagnosis in North Shields is a “torn meniscus” or cartilage damage. Patients are often told that their shock absorbers are worn out and that surgery is the only option to “clean it out.”
However, modern research shows that the meniscus is not just a passive washer; it is a highly innervated sensory organ. It is packed with nerve endings that tell the brain exactly how the knee is loaded.
When the meniscus is damaged, it sends a high-volume “error signal” to the brain. The brain perceives this as a major threat to stability. In response, it creates Arthrogenic Muscle Inhibition (AMI)-it shuts down the quadriceps muscle to stop you from putting weight on the leg.
Often, the pain you feel is not from the tear itself (many tears are painless), but from the lack of muscular support caused by this neurological shutdown. The joint feels unstable and painful because the muscles aren’t doing their job.
Our treatment focuses on “calming” the sensory nerves in the meniscus and “waking up” the quadriceps. By restoring the neural connection to the muscle, we can stabilise the joint. Many of our clients are able to return to full activity without surgery, simply by restoring the neurological control of the knee.

A common mistake we see in our active Gosforth clients is trying to “stretch away” knee pain. You feel tight in the quads or IT band, so you use a foam roller aggressively.
However, muscle tightness is often a protective mechanism. If your brain feels your knee is unstable-perhaps due to a previous ligament injury or poor balance-it tightens the IT band and hamstrings to act as a splint.
If you aggressively roll or stretch these tissues, you are essentially removing the brain’s safety mechanism. The brain often responds by tightening them up even more to re-establish stability, or by increasing the pain signal. This creates a cycle of pain and frustration.
We don’t force mobility. We give the brain the stability it craves. We might use exercises to activate the deep stabilising muscles or correct a visual tracking issue. Once the brain feels stable, it voluntarily releases the tight muscles, giving you flexibility “for free” without the need for painful rolling.

We follow a logical, evidence-based process:
1. De-sensitisation: When you first come in, your nervous system is likely in a panic. We use gentle techniques to calm it down. We avoid aggressive bending or forcing the knee straight in the early stages if the system is highly sensitive.
2. Creating Space: We use specific manual techniques to mobilise the knee joint and the ankle. A stiff ankle forces the knee to do too much work. By mobilising the ankle, we take the pressure off the knee.
3. Neural Health: Nerves run past the knee joint (the saphenous and peroneal nerves). If they are tethered by swelling or scar tissue, every step hurts. We use “nerve flossing” to get them gliding freely again.
4. Strength and Integration: We rebuild your movement patterns. We teach you how to squat and lunge using your powerful hip muscles, ensuring the knee is protected during load.
